Metastasis as the first sign of thyroid cancer.

L Pomorski1, M Bartos.   

Abstract

The aim of this paper is to review our experience with patients who presented with a metastatic tumor in the lymph nodes or other organs as the first sign of thyroid cancer. In 1974-1998, 18 602 patients were operated on due to goitre. There were 975 (5.2%) patients with thyroid malignant neoplasms. The group comprised 449 (46.1%) patients with papillary carcinoma, 309 (31.7%) with follicular carcinoma, 54 (5.5%) with medullary carcinoma, 106 (10.9%) with anaplastic carcinoma, and 57 (5.8%) with other types of thyroid malignant neoplasms. Out of these 975 patients, thyroid cancer was diagnosed on the basis of the detection of a metastatic tumor in 26 (2.7%) patients. In 16 (61.5%) of these patients the metastatic tumor was located in the regional lymph nodes. In 10 (38.5%) patients distant metastasis beyond the regional lymph nodes was the first sign of thyroid cancer. In (50%) patients metastasis was located in the bones, in 2 (20%) in the lung, in 1 (10%) in the heart, in 1 (10%) in the buttock, and in 1 (10%) in a central neck cyst. Metastasis was the initial manifestation of thyroid cancer in 18 (4%) of 449 papillary carcinoma patients, in 6 of 309 (1.9%) follicular carcinoma patients, and in 2 (3.7%) of 54 medullary carcinoma patients. Lymph node metastasis was the first sign of thyroid cancer in 13 (2.9%) patients with papillary carcinoma, 1 (0.3%) patients with follicular carcinoma and in 2 (3.7%) medullary carcinoma patients, and distant metastasis in 5 (1.1%) patients with papillary carcinoma and in 5 (1.6%) patients with follicular carcinoma. After the detection of the primary focus of thyroid cancer total thyroidectomy and modified neck dissection were performed in all patients. Differentiated thyroid carcinoma patients were treated complementarily with 131I and TSH suppressive doses of L-thyroxine, and medullary cancer patients with teleradiotherapy and substitutive doses of L-thyroxine.
